Output e77893a91e350dc3807a568f33a4662d1a9e24b9a02b8446bb40248ea6530e44:1

value
25121084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8b1e7db1fb6ffcfdd87a2944973d3a6dd366128 OP_EQUAL
address
3NuPp9nVTvzwAp1KYC4Ym7R1Z4XLBjBe8S
transaction
e77893a91e350dc3807a568f33a4662d1a9e24b9a02b8446bb40248ea6530e44
spent
true